10 Best HTML Projects + Source Code in 2023 Beginner to Pro

For click, you can use either javascript or CSS bookmark option. You don’t need to make it too fancy, just give it a simple and descent look, that looks good for technical documentation. If you have in-depth knowledge of HTML5 and CSS3, you can make a one-page responsive photography site. Add the company name with an image (related to photography) on the top (landing page). Mention the contact detail of the photographer at the bottom (footer).
The majority of individuals chose HTML and CSS projects as their entry point into the world of coding because they are the simplest to learn. The versatility of the Python language makes it optimal to learn as a first language alongside JavaScript. The language is concise, reads easily, and looks great when you include it as part of your programmer stack. Python is also great for building data science and software applications. Every development project you tackle doesn’t need to be complicated.

  • The most efficient method to learn any language, including HTML, is through projects.
  • Do you use it to make online purchases, listen to music, or view videos?
  • If you get stuck at any point while building these HTML projects, consider checking out an HTML cheat sheet for some quick help.
  • The concept is to design a responsive one-page photography website.
  • You must be familiar with this language if your profession or daily life involves working with code, websites, or apps.

Make it responsive setting a viewport, using media queries and grid. A landing page is another good project you can make using HTML and CSS but it requires a solid knowledge of these two building blocks. You will be using lots of creativity while making a landing page.

Make a JavaScript quiz game

Because it’s not a programming language, it doesn’t perform anything dynamic; it only helps with site structure and layout. The simplest code defines how each website component should be shown. Include the brand name, logo, and a succinct site description at the top of the landing page. Users can access the images portion of a gallery and slide to view the subsequent photographs by creating a gallery with a view button. You can maintain many viewing configurations, such as a grid, list, etc.
html web development projects
For this project, we’ll create a website that will have a navigation bar and four links that will help us to navigate to different pages. Web development projects are available online, along with their proper explanation to help you understand the requirements better. Learn the basics like HTML, CSS, PHP, JS, or any other language best suited for your project.2.
They move from one spot on the page to another using navigation links or scrolling down to look at different content sections. If you’re looking for a challenging HTML project to showcase your coding chops, why not try creating a browser-based game using HTML, CSS, and JavaScript? Or it can include multi-player capabilities and/or leaderboards for players who wish to compare scores with others. This project involves cloning the popular video-sharing site YouTube from scratch. Interactivity can also be added with special events providing further access to additional options within the experience itself. Creating your own personal portfolio page requires a grasp of HTML5 and CSS3.

Beginner project: Hamburger menu

Making a layout for a restaurant will be a bit complicated than previous project examples. You will be aligning the different food items and drinks using a CSS layout grid. You will be adding prices, images and you need to give it a beautiful look and feel as well using the proper combination of colors, font-style and images. You can add pictures gallery for different food items, you can also add sliding images for a better look.

HTML web development


But still, it’s a good place to find inspiration and new ideas. To get started, follow this freeCodeCamp tutorial to build a simple landing page. If you are not familiar with JavaScript, leave those features out for now and come back to them later. For this project, create a simple HTML file and style it with CSS. Be sure to include a headline, some text about the company or its services, and a call-to-action (CTA) button.
The Youtube clone project is largely used to assess participants’ HTML, CSS, and Responsive design abilities. Users should establish channels and post videos, and these functionalities should be available. In addition, be sure to have text sections that allow for comments, as well as a search engine, on your website.

Intermediate HTML Projects with Source Code

Placing your website navigation inside a sidebar toggle is an easy way to clean up the overall look and feel of your design. HTML and CSS are the most fundamental languages for front-end web development. In terms of functionality, you will create an electronic program that functions just like a messaging app, such as Whatsapp. While you may personalize it to your liking, you should include text-based communication technology and data administration foundations.
html web development projects
You get the chance to practice Python concepts like using Lists and the input() function. The challenge also comes from learning to apply your computational and creative skills to a web project. You’ll have to figure out how to structure data to make it easier to determine a winner.
You should include a search engine with filters in the clone and a marketing ambience that matches the original. Make sure you include a secure payment area that keeps consumers’ credit card and bank account information safe. Aesthetics are just as important as functionality for a business structure.

Learning to work with tools like Firebase is a bonus when making the React app. Clients might hire you to design a single-page layout for a portfolio or event website. Businesses may call upon you to add a new page to their site. New coders can do this easily using vanilla JavaScript, PHP, HTML, or CSS.
html web development projects
This button will directly bring you down to the images section. You need to take care of the margin, padding, color combination, font-size, font-style, image size and styling of a button. The creation of a landing page demands a basic understanding of HTML and CSS.

People who are interested in attending the conference create a register button for them. Mention different links for speaker, venue and schedule at the top in the header section. Describe the purpose of https://www.globalcloudteam.com/ the conference or the category of people who can get benefit from this conference. Add an introduction and images of the speaker, venue detail and the main purpose of the conference on your webpage.

Related article

  • NLP can even assist clinicians identify sufferers vulnerable to creating sure circumstances or predict their outcomes, permitting for more customized and efficient therapy. Clinical Decision Support (CDS) methods are designed to reinforce affected person safety…

    Read more...
  • These milestones underscore the significance of design systems as indispensable parts of contemporary digital toolkits. Today, design methods are complete assets that guide the creation of digital merchandise, guaranteeing they are not only visually cohesive…

    Read more...
  • It can even take over and gradual or cease the automobile if the driving force doesn’t have time to reply. If a automobile needs service, an automated chatbot can set up and make sure appointments…

    Read more...

Leave a comment

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*